What is Rs organic chemistry?

The R / S system is an important nomenclature system for denoting enantiomers. This approach labels each chiral center R or S according to a system by which its substituents are each assigned a priority, according to the Cahn–Ingold–Prelog priority rules (CIP), based on atomic number.

How do I find my RS configuration?

Draw an arrow starting from priority one and going to priority two and then to priority 3: If the arrow goes clockwise, like in this case, the absolute configuration is R. As opposed to this, if the arrow goes counterclockwise then the absolute configuration is S.

What is the RS system of nomenclature?

R/S system of nomenclature is a naming system used for assigning absolute configuration to chiral molecules. R, Latin 'Rectus' meaning right, and S, Latin 'Sinister' meaning left.Oct 21, 2021

How are enantiomers named?

4.4: Naming Enantiomers

The naming of enantiomers employs the Cahn–Ingold–Prelog rules that involve assigning priorities to different substituent groups at a chiral center. Each enantiomer, being a distinct molecule, is assigned a unique name by the Cahn–Ingold–Prelog (CIP) rules, also called the R–S system.

How is Rs system better than DL?

(D-L system labels the whole molecule, while R/S system labels the absolute configuration of each chirality center.) In short, the D-L system doesn't have direct connection to (+)/(-) notation. It only relates the stereochemistry of the compound with that of glyceraldehyde, but says nothing about its optical activity.Jul 14, 2017

Is carbon B a double bond?

However, because of the double bond, carbon “b” is treated as if it is connected to two oxygens. The same rule is applied for any other double or triple bond. So, when you see a double bond count it as two single bonds when you see a triple bond cut it as three single bonds.

Is carbon a chiral atom?

Carbon is not the only atom designated by R and S. In theory, any atom with four different groups is chiral and can be described by the R and S system. For example, phosphorous and sulfur chiral centers are often assigned as R or S. Hydrogen is not always the lowest priority. A lone pair of electrons is lower.

What does R stand for in chemistry?

R is an abbreviation for radical, when the term radical applied to a portion of a complete molecule (not necessarily a free radical), such as a methyl group. Should not be confused with R (the gas constant), R (the one-letter abbreviation for the amino acid arginine) or R (a designation of absolute configuration).

17 hours ago May 14, 2016 · R and S refer to the absolute configuration possessed by the chiral centre. Explanation: L short for laevorotatory and D (dextrorotatory) refer to the direction, anticlockwise, or clockwise, that a solution of the molecule rotates plane-polarized light. It is a bit of an old-fashioned term, but it relates SOLELY to the experimental result.
